Tonight’s council meeting was Paul Burke’s last – confirming rumours that his tenure of 17 years at Glen Eira is now over. Whether this is a ‘willing departure’ or a forced one is open to speculation of course. However, it is our belief that there was still plenty of time left on his current contract.
We can only hope that Ms McKenzie is slowly but surely putting her stamp on a new, community oriented council that pays much, much more than lip service to the ideals of working with and for residents. Judging by tonight’s performance by the vast majority of councillors, they still have to learn this lesson!
